Pro Tip for Personalization
Pro Tip: Don’t just stop at crayons! Encourage your little ones to add glitter, stickers, or even a handwritten note on the back to make the coloring page feel extra special. It adds a layer of texture and personality that transforms a simple sheet of paper into a cherished piece of art.

Setting the Scene for Success
If you want to make this a memorable event, turn it into a mini-art party. Lay out a variety of art supplies—think markers, colored pencils, and pastels—and put on some background music. When you make the act of creating the gift just as important as the final product, the kids stay engaged longer and put more thoughtful effort into their work.
